The Asset Accounting (FI-AA) component is used for managing
and supervising fixed assets with the SAP R/3 System. In
SAP R/3 Financial Accounting, it serves as a subsidiary
ledger to the FI General Ledger, providing detailed
information on transactions involving fixed assets.
